I agree with Christy that Timespan is a very good friend.
I used to take two a day; one before bed, and one in the morning, but I'm finding that taking one at night only is good. I take 60mgs of the regular every 3-hours during waking hours, and that does the trick during the day.
When I was taking the timespan during the day, I was also taking 60mgs every 5-hours, and I was experiencing major overdose symptoms at certain times of the day. However, during these overdose periods, my muscles worked better. This was all during the initial period of starting prednisone. I think that the prednisone has finally worked to the level it's going to work at, so 60mgs every 3-hrs is sufficient, without the overdose sx (thank God).
